Description:
The internal organization of a parliament determines its ability to perform its various functions. This section focuses on the parliamentary institution, its structure, organization and ways to making it more efficient and effective. Selected resources include research and publications on parliamentary administrations, internal rules and procedures and codes of conduct. Parliamentary committees receive further attention being the main venue that allows the parliamentarians to carry out their different legislative, oversight, budgeting, and representative roles. Resources are also available on parliamentary caucuses and party groups given their key role in empowering parliamentarians and allowing them to have greater influence within the parliament. Finally, several guides and manuals available in this section target developing parliamentary administration and functioning through the use of ICT.
